About A Prayer for the Wild at Heart
Taken from a Tennessee Williams play, A Prayer for the Wild at Heart on Hurtle Square in the middle of Adelaide's CBD is a love letter to the hospitality industry. The sibling restaurant to the multi-award-winning My Kingdom for a Horse, this venue is suited to all occasions from casual catch-ups to an intimate dinner in stylish surrounds of marble, polished wood and a well-stocked bar promising a cheeky cocktail or two. Start a memorable meal with duck liver parfait on brioche fingers, before char-grilled octopus salad and harissa dressing; for the main, don’t go past Stephane’s housemade Toulouse-style sausage with mustard, shave fennel and apple, or seared duck breast with Parisian peas and orange gastrique. Those looking to share opt for beef Chateaubriand, mustard and bearnaise sauce.
